The trailer for Spider-Man: No Way Home has reportedly leaked before Sony officially released it. Spider-Man: No Way Home, the third installment of Marvel's Spider-Man trilogy with Tom Holland as Peter Parker, also includes Doctor Strange, played by Benedict Cumberbatch, in a leading role. Spider-Man: No Way Home is scheduled for a December release and Sony hasn't started the film's marketing campaign yet.

Disney and Sony have been pretty quiet about the film, fueling fan desire for SOME kind of information. There have been reports that Tobey Maguire and Andrew Garfield are both returning as the new film handles the multiverse, which opens possibilities of multiple Spider-Men.

While Maguire and Garfield casting rumors are not confirmed, we do know that Alfred Molina is reprising his role as Doc Ock from Spider-Man 2. Jamie Foxx has also been cast as Electro and rumors are also rampant that we'll be seeing Charlie Cox's Daredevil and Willem Dafoe's Green Goblin.

The Hollywood Reporter wrote that the Spider-Man: No Way Home trailer leaked and was being shown all over Twitter and TikTok. Sony quickly slapped out copyright notices and removed the videos, indicating that the trailer was likely real. It was also said to be watermarked with Wassila Lmouaci's name, a VFX artist who worked on Thor: Ragnarok.

As for Disney, the marketing president Asad Ayaz told THR, "Sony is absolutely handling the marketing for Spider-Man. Kevin Feige and his team are closely partnering with the Sony team on those. So there is coordination in that sense. We also make sure we are aware of who is dropping what when. But we are not working together on the campaigns because it's their film. They are handling it but there is a level of coordination to make sure that it's a win-win for everybody."

The trailer is rumored to premiere at Las Vegas' CinemaCon, beginning today, which means we would've likely seen at least descriptions by now. But with the leak, Sony may just go ahead and release the whole thing. Kevin Feige said that the trailer will premiere before the film goes to theaters (makes sense).

Spider-Man: No Way Home is probably one of the most anticipated films of the year. Merchandise is already hitting stores and Sony is really playing up the anticipation for the movie. Shang-Chi comes out next week and studios will likely want the Spider-Man trailer to play before that movie.
